An airborne photograph, in wide terms, is any type of photo extracted from the air. Generally, air pictures are taken up and down from an airplane making use of a highly-accurate video camera. There are numerous points you can seek to determine what makes one picture different from another of the very same location including sort of movie, scale, and overlap.


The complying with material will aid you recognize the principles of airborne photography by clarifying these standard technological principles. most air photo missions are flown utilizing black and white movie, nonetheless colour, infrared, and false-colour infrared film are often made use of for special jobs. the range from the middle of the cam lens to the focal plane (i.e.

As focal length rises, photo distortion lowers. The focal size is specifically measured when the video camera is adjusted. the proportion of the range in between 2 factors on an image to the real distance between the exact same 2 factors on the ground (i.e. 1 device on the photo equates to "x" units on the ground).


The area of ground protection that is seen on the photo is less than at smaller ranges. A small range photo just means that ground attributes are at a smaller, much less detailed size.


Image centres are represented by tiny circles, and straight lines are drawn attaching the circles to show pictures on the same trip line. This graphical depiction is called an air image index map, and it enables you to associate the images to their geographical place. Small-scale pictures are indexed on 1:250 000 range NTS map sheets, and larger-scale photographs are indexed on 1:50 000 range NTS maps.

Aerial Survey is a form of collection of geographical info utilizing air-borne cars. aerial data collection methods. The collection of details can be made using different modern technologies such as aerial photography, radar, laser or from remote picking up images using other bands of the electro-magnetic range, such as infrared, gamma, or ultraviolet. For the details gathered to be beneficial this information requires to be georeferenced


Airborne Evaluating is usually done utilizing manned aeroplanes where the sensing units (cams, radars, lasers, detectors, etc) and the GNSS receiver are setup and are adjusted for the appropriate georeferencing of the collected information. Besides manned aeroplanes, various other aerial lorries can be likewise used such as UAVs, balloons, helicopters. Generally for this kind of applications, kinematic techniques are made use of.

Numerous overlapping images - called stereo imagery - are collected as the sensing unit flies along a trip path. Images has perspective geometry that results in distortions that are special to each image.




Stereo images is produced from two or even more photos of the very same ground feature gathered from various geolocation positions. The design for creating these 3D datasets requires a collection of several overlapping photos with no gaps in overlap, sensing unit calibration and alignment information, and ground control and connection factors.


Mapping refers to the edgematching, cutline generation, and color balancing of several images to create an orthomosaic dataset. Digital aerial photos, drone images, scanned aerial photos, and satellite images are vital in general mapping and in GIS data generation and visualization.


First, the imagery functions as a backdrop that provides GIS layers essential context where to make geospatial organizations. Second, images is made use of to develop or revise maps and GIS layers by digitizing and associating functions of rate of interest such as roads, buildings, hydrology, and greenery. Before this geospatial info can be digitized from imagery, the imagery needs to be fixed for different types of errors and distortions fundamental in the method imagery is gathered.

Radiometric mistake is brought on by the sun's azimuth and elevation, atmospheric problems, and sensor limitations. Geometric distortionThe inaccurate translation of range and area in the photo. Geometric mistake is triggered by surface displacement, the curvature of the Earth, perspective estimates and instrumentation. Each of these sorts of inaccuracies are eliminated in the orthorectification and mapping process.


As soon as the distortions impacting imagery are eliminated and individual pictures or scenes are mosaicked with each other to create an orthomosaic, it might be utilized like a symbolic or thematic map to make exact distance and angle dimensions. The advantage of the orthoimage is that it consists of all the information visible in the images, not just the attributes and GIS layers extracted from the photo and represented on a map.


One of one of the most crucial products generated by the photogrammetric procedure is an orthorectified collection of pictures, called an orthoimage mosaic, or simply orthomosaic. The generation of the orthoimage involves contorting the source picture so that distance and area are consistent in partnership to real-world measurements. This is achieved by establishing the partnership of the x, y image collaborates to real-world GCPs to establish the algorithm for resampling the picture.
